The film reveals his transformation from a grieving son (after Themistokles kills his father, King Darius) into a "God-King" through a dark, mystical ritual in the desert. Artemisia:
Her backstory explains her hatred for Greece; she was a Greek-born girl whose family was murdered by Greek hoplites, leading her to defect and train as a lethal Persian warrior.

The film received mixed reviews from critics but was praised for Eva Green’s performance and its visually striking action sequences. It grossed over $337 million worldwide against a $110 million budget.
